A Bulletin Fails to Install and Throws Return Code 5100 A New Version has Been Detected on this Machine
search cancel

A Bulletin Fails to Install and Throws Return Code 5100 A New Version has Been Detected on this Machine

book

Article ID: 244474

calendar_today

Updated On:

Products

Patch Management Solution IT Management Suite

Issue/Introduction

In this particular case the problem bulletin was MS11-025 / Q2467173 / vcredist2467173_x86.exe.  However, this could happen with any bulletin.  When reviewing the return code, you see it failed with 5100.  The next step in troubleshooting this type of problem is to manually run the security update to see what it says.  When doing so, you get something like the following:

Environment

Release: 8.6

 

Cause

The operating system is not allowing you to install the update.  This is due to an older version of the product.

Resolution

We can see that our detection is accurate and that file is out of date, but the OS won't allow you to install that update.  I would recommend uninstalling the 2010 redist from Control Panel and then installing that new version (or just a later one entirely if 2010 is not specifically required).  Uninstalling and then installing the later version should bring the files inline with the version the OS thinks is installed.